Titled 1952 Harley Panhead chopper.  Know very little about its condition.  Starts on the third kick and goes through the gears.
Smokes a little, leaks some engine oil and could possibly need rebuilding. . Oil pump has a check valve problem, a shut off valve stops the leak when not in use. The generator, relay and speedometer are not working.  Has a new 6 volt battery.  No front brake, no horn, a slightly out of round front rim.
